こちらの記事を参考にして、Gulp を TFS ビルドと Web デプロイに統合しようとしています。コマンド (Alt+B+R) を使用してソリューションをビルドすると、gulp によって出力ディレクトリが正常に作成されます。しかし、ビルド定義を右クリックして新しいビルドをキューに入れようとすると、ビルドは次のエラーで失敗します。
誰でもこのエラーを取り除くのを助けることができますか?
こちらの記事を参考にして、Gulp を TFS ビルドと Web デプロイに統合しようとしています。コマンド (Alt+B+R) を使用してソリューションをビルドすると、gulp によって出力ディレクトリが正常に作成されます。しかし、ビルド定義を右クリックして新しいビルドをキューに入れようとすると、ビルドは次のエラーで失敗します。
誰でもこのエラーを取り除くのを助けることができますか?
エラーTF42097 によると: フィールドにエラーが発生したため、作業項目を保存できませんでした。
ビルドはデフォルト テンプレート (またはカスタマイズ) を使用し、失敗時にワーク アイテムを作成するオプションがオンになっていますが、バグ ワーク アイテムは、ビルドが作成できないことを意味するように変更されています。フィールドを必須にする。
これを修正する方法は、バグ作業項目がどのように制限されているかによって異なります。必須になった作業項目フィールドには、ビルド プロセス テンプレートで値を指定する必要があります。その値がビルド定義によって異なる場合は、定義で引数として公開する必要があります。
この状況の回避策:
PropertyGroup を追加すると<SkipWorkItemCreation>true</SkipWorkItemCreation>
、作業項目の作成が試行されなくなります。
MSDNからの同様の質問を参照してください。